ARS Pharmaceuticals (SPRY) faces a securities lawsuit alleging false statements about CVS Caremark formulary decisions for Neffy, potentially delaying commercialization. The complaint covers March 9 to June 24, 2026 with a lead-plaintiff deadline of October 5, 2026. The case adds legal headwinds but relies on unproven claims, likely causing only near-term volatility.
